Ariana Grande officially files divorce from husband Dalton Gomez



Ariana Grande, the renowned American singer, and her husband, Dalton Gomez, a luxury real estate agent, have filed for divorce after two years of marriage.

The divorce proceedings have begun, with Grande citing “irreconcilable differences” as the reason for dissolution.

The news of their separation had initially surfaced in July, and the couple had been working through the details of their separation privately, characterized as “kind and patient.”

A source close to the situation stated, “They’ve been really caring and respectful of one another through every step of this process.”

Ariana Grande and Dalton Gomez, both 30 and 28 years old, respectively, got married in an intimate ceremony on May 15, 2021, after announcing their engagement in December 2020.

Their relationship, which began in January 2020, had been largely private, with the couple keeping their personal lives out of the spotlight.

Despite this, Grande had previously shared their wedding anniversary on social media, expressing her love for Gomez.

Following news of their separation, it was revealed that Grande had been dating Ethan Slater her co-star on her upcoming movie “Wicked”, who also had separated from his wife earlier.

However, sources have emphasized that Grande and Slater’s relationship began only after both parties were separated from their respective partners.
